Springs Road Car Care - Web springs road car care center has 1 locations, listed below. Web ( 175 reviews ) 1875 12th avenue northeast. *this company may be headquartered in or have additional. Fortunately, getting your vehicle serviced doesn't have to be. Routine maintenance is a big part of owning a vehicle.
Web springs road car care center has 1 locations, listed below. Fortunately, getting your vehicle serviced doesn't have to be. Web ( 175 reviews ) 1875 12th avenue northeast. Routine maintenance is a big part of owning a vehicle. *this company may be headquartered in or have additional.